A Cooler Climate   1999     2 stars    R, 100 min.
Genre: Drama
Director: Susan Seidelman  
Cast: Sally Field, Judy Davis, Winston Rekert, Jerry Wasserman, Carly Pope, Jessalyn Gilsig, Gerard Plunkett, Alec Willows, Denalda Williams, Peter Yunker

  Iris (Sally Field) is recently divorced and must seek work. She takes a job as housekeeper for bitter, wealthy Paula (Judy Davis), who takes her frustrations out on Iris. After Paula's marriage falls apart, a friendship with Iris develops. And now a word from our soapsuds sponsor.

Eight Below   2006     2 and a half stars    PG, 120 min.
Genre: Adventure
Director: Frank Marshall  
Cast: Paul Walker, Bruce Greenwood, Moon Bloodgood, Jason Biggs, Gerard Plunkett, Panou, August Schellenberg, Wendy Crewson, Belinda Metz, Connor Christopher Levins, Brenda Campbell, Malcolm Stewart, Duncan Fraser

  Loosely based on a true story, the focus is on the fate of Jerry Shepherd's team of sled dogs that are left behind in the Antarctic when explorers must evacuate the area during a severe storm. The dogs must survive alone over a six-month period while Jerry Shepherd fails in his attempts to rescue them. Survive they do, and their adventures provide good entertainment.

Galaxy Express 999   1979     3 stars    PG, 91 min.
Genre: Animation / Adventure / Sci-Fi / Fantasy
aka: Galaxy Express

Director: Rintaro  
Cast: Saffron Henderson, Kathleen Barr, Janyse Jaud, Terry Klassen, Nicole Oliver, John Payne, Scott McNeil, Paul Dobson, Daphne Goldrick, Don Brown, Jane Perry, Willow Johnson, Fay McKay, Gerard Plunkett

  This Japanese animated film, though made for children, may be somewhat intense for many, as young Tetsuro Hoshino (voice of Saffron Henderson) travels on a locomotive through the universe searching for immortality. His mother was murdered by Count Mecha (voice of Paul Dobson) whose body has been replaced by mechanical parts. A mysterious woman, Maetel (voice of Kathleen Barr), joins Tetsuro on his search for eternal life, and, along the way, they experience many fantastic adventures.

Movie PictureSnakes on a Plane   2006     2 and a half stars    R, 105 min.
Genre: Action / Thriller
Director: David R. Ellis  
Cast: Samuel L. Jackson, Julianna Margulies, Nathan Phillips, Rachel Blanchard, Byron Lawson, Flex Alexander, Kenan Thompson, Keith Dallas, Lin Shaye, Bruce James, Sunny Mabrey, Casey Dubois, Gerard Plunkett, Elsa Pataky

  FBI agent Nelville Flynn (Samuel L. Jackson) is escorting murder witness Sean Jones (Nathan Phillips) on a plane from Hawaii to Los Angeles where Jones will testify against crime lord Eddie Kim (Byron Lawson). In an effort to prevent Sean from testifying, Kim plots to release a crate of poisonous snakes that–after coming in contact with pheremone infested leis that will drive them wild–will attack and kill those aboard the plane.

Two for the Money   2005     2 stars    R, 122 min.
Genre: Drama
Director: D.J. Caruso  
Cast: Al Pacino, Matthew McConaughey, Rene Russo, Jeremy Piven, Armand Assante, Jaime King, Kevin Chapman, Ralph Garman, Gedde Watanabe, Carly Pope, Charles Carroll, Gerard Plunkett

  Bookie Walter Abrams (Al Pacino) mentors former college football star Brandon Lang (Matthew McConaughey) because of Brandon's unique ability to predict sporting events' wins and losses. Abrams changes Brandon's name to John Anthony and puts him on his TV show advising wheelers and dealers where to make their fortunes through sports bets.

Wrongfully Accused   1998     1 star    PG-13, 85 min.
Genre: Comedy
Director: Pat Proft  
Cast: Leslie Nielsen, Kelly LeBrock, Richard Crenna, Michael York, Melinda McGraw, Aaron Pearl, Pat Proft, Sandra Bernhard, Gerard Plunkett, Leslie Jones

  Ryan Harrison (Leslie Nielsen) has been wrongfully accused of murder and is sentenced to death. But he manages a last minute escape, and now the law is in hot pursuit as Harrison tries to find the real killer.
